#1e175c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1e175c is composed of 11.8% red, 9% green and 36.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.4% cyan, 75% magenta, 0% yellow and 63.9% black. It has a hue angle of 246.1 degrees, a saturation of 60% and a lightness of 22.5%. #1e175c color hex could be obtained by blending #3c2eb8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330066.

#1e175c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1e175c has RGB values of R:30, G:23, B:92 and CMYK values of C:0.67, M:0.75, Y:0, K:0.64. Its decimal value is 1972060.

Shades and Tints of #1e175c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#04030e is the darkest color, while #fdfd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#1e175c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#37363d is the less saturated color, while #0c0172 is the most saturated one.
